
Excel表格单位换算方法有多种:使用转换函数、手动计算、利用查找替换功能、编写宏、安装插件。 例如,使用转换函数可以自动完成单位之间的转换,减少手动计算的工作量和错误。下面将详细介绍每种方法及其应用场景。
一、使用转换函数
Excel 提供了内置的 CONVERT 函数,可以在不同单位之间进行转换。CONVERT 函数的语法为:CONVERT(number, from_unit, to_unit)。
1.1 函数语法和参数
CONVERT 函数的语法为:CONVERT(number, from_unit, to_unit)。其中,number 是要转换的数值,from_unit 是原单位,to_unit 是目标单位。Excel 支持多种单位,例如长度、重量、温度等。
1.2 具体使用方法
例如,要将英尺转换为米,可以使用以下公式:
=CONVERT(10, "ft", "m")
上述公式将把 10 英尺转换为米。Excel 中支持的单位非常多,可以在官方文档中找到具体的单位代码。
1.3 常见单位代码
以下是一些常用的单位代码:
- 长度单位:米(m)、千米(km)、英尺(ft)、英寸(in)
- 重量单位:千克(kg)、克(g)、磅(lb)、盎司(oz)
- 温度单位:摄氏度(C)、华氏度(F)、开尔文(K)
二、手动计算
在某些情况下,可能需要手动进行单位转换。手动计算需要了解转换关系,并通过公式进行计算。
2.1 长度单位转换
例如,将英尺转换为米,1 英尺等于 0.3048 米,可以使用以下公式:
=A1 * 0.3048
其中,A1 是包含要转换数值的单元格。
2.2 重量单位转换
例如,将磅转换为千克,1 磅等于 0.453592 千克,可以使用以下公式:
=A1 * 0.453592
2.3 温度单位转换
例如,将华氏度转换为摄氏度,可以使用以下公式:
=(A1 - 32) * 5 / 9
三、利用查找替换功能
在 Excel 中,可以利用查找替换功能进行单位转换。此方法适用于需要批量替换特定单位的情况。
3.1 查找替换操作
例如,要将工作表中的所有英尺单位替换为米单位,可以按以下步骤操作:
- 按 Ctrl + H 打开查找和替换对话框。
- 在“查找内容”框中输入要查找的单位(如“ft”)。
- 在“替换为”框中输入目标单位(如“m”)。
- 点击“全部替换”按钮。
3.2 结合公式使用
查找替换功能可以与公式结合使用,以实现更复杂的单位转换。例如,可以先将单位替换为空白,然后使用公式进行数值转换。
四、编写宏
Excel 提供了强大的宏功能,可以编写自定义宏进行单位转换。宏可以自动化重复性任务,提高工作效率。
4.1 创建宏
要创建宏,可以按以下步骤操作:
- 按 Alt + F11 打开 VBA 编辑器。
- 在 VBA 编辑器中,插入一个新模块。
- 在模块中编写宏代码。
4.2 宏代码示例
以下是一个将英尺转换为米的宏代码示例:
Sub ConvertFeetToMeters()
Dim cell As Range
For Each cell In Selection
If IsNumeric(cell.Value) Then
cell.Value = cell.Value * 0.3048
End If
Next cell
End Sub
4.3 运行宏
编写好宏后,可以通过以下步骤运行宏:
- 选择要转换的单元格区域。
- 按 Alt + F8 打开宏对话框。
- 选择要运行的宏,点击“运行”按钮。
五、安装插件
除了内置功能和自定义宏外,还可以安装第三方插件进行单位转换。许多插件提供了丰富的单位转换功能和更友好的用户界面。
5.1 查找和安装插件
可以通过以下步骤查找和安装插件:
- 打开 Excel,点击“文件”菜单。
- 选择“选项”,然后点击“加载项”。
- 在加载项管理器中,选择“Excel 加载项”,点击“转到”按钮。
- 在弹出的对话框中,勾选需要的插件,点击“确定”按钮。
5.2 使用插件
安装好插件后,可以根据插件的说明文档进行使用。不同插件的操作方法可能有所不同,但通常都比较直观易用。
总结
Excel 提供了多种单位转换的方法,可以根据具体需求选择合适的方式。使用转换函数是最简单直接的方法,适用于大多数情况;手动计算适用于特定单位转换;查找替换功能适用于批量替换单位;编写宏可以自动化复杂任务;安装插件可以扩展功能和提高效率。
通过掌握这些方法,可以有效地进行单位转换,提高工作效率和数据处理的准确性。
相关问答FAQs:
1. 如何在Excel表格中进行单位换算?
在Excel中进行单位换算非常简单。首先,选择需要进行换算的单元格,然后使用乘法或除法公式来完成换算。例如,如果要将英寸转换为厘米,可以将英寸值乘以2.54。如果要将摄氏度转换为华氏度,可以使用公式:华氏度 = 摄氏度 * 1.8 + 32。Excel的数学函数也可以用于单位换算,如CONVERT函数可用于转换长度、重量、时间等单位。
2. 如何将Excel表格中的数据从一个单位转换为另一个单位?
如果你想将Excel表格中的数据从一个单位转换为另一个单位,可以使用Excel的数据分析工具。首先,选择需要转换的数据范围,然后点击Excel菜单栏中的"数据"选项,再选择"数据分析"。在数据分析对话框中,选择"转换"选项,然后选择需要转换的单位和目标单位。点击"确定"后,Excel将自动将选定的数据从一个单位转换为另一个单位。
3. 如何在Excel表格中进行货币单位换算?
在Excel中进行货币单位换算非常简单。首先,确保你的数据是以数值格式输入的,然后选择需要进行换算的单元格。接下来,使用乘法或除法公式来完成货币单位换算。例如,如果要将美元转换为人民币,可以将美元值乘以汇率。你还可以使用Excel的货币格式功能来显示换算后的结果。选择转换后的单元格,然后在Excel菜单栏中选择"开始"选项卡,点击"货币"按钮,选择适当的货币格式即可显示换算后的结果。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4725752